#e6d5c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6d5c4 is composed of 90.2% red, 83.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.4% magenta, 14.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 83.5%. #e6d5c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cdab89.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#e6d5c4 color description : Light grayish orange.
#e6d5c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6d5c4 has RGB values of R:230, G:213,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.15,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15128004.
